How To Fix /SCWM/WHO413 - Warehouse order &1 already canceled; no change possible


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: /SCWM/WHO -

  • Message number: 413

  • Message text: Warehouse order &1 already canceled; no change possible

    The SAP error message /SCWM/WHO413 Warehouse order &1 already canceled; no change possible typically occurs in the SAP Extended Warehouse Management (EWM) module when you attempt to make changes to a warehouse order that has already been canceled. Here’s a breakdown of the cause, potential solutions, and related information:

    Cause:

    1. Warehouse Order Status: The warehouse order you are trying to modify has already been canceled. In SAP EWM, once a warehouse order is canceled, it cannot be changed or processed further.
    2. User Action: The error may arise from a user trying to reprocess or change the details of a warehouse order that is no longer valid due to its canceled status.

    Solution:

    1. Check Warehouse Order Status: Verify the status of the warehouse order in question. You can do this by navigating to the relevant transaction or using the appropriate report to check the status of warehouse orders.
    2. No Changes Allowed: Since the order is already canceled, you cannot make any changes to it. If you need to perform actions related to this order, you may need to create a new warehouse order instead.
    3. Review Cancellation Process: If the cancellation was not intended, review the process that led to the cancellation. Ensure that the cancellation was performed correctly and that it aligns with your warehouse management processes.
